Transaction 638e84255d45d99258512090d5090501c2f31624649c69e3cbeda13495098016
1 Input
1 Output
-
638e84255d45d99258512090d5090501c2f31624649c69e3cbeda13495098016:0
- value
- 28907145
- script pubkey
- OP_0 OP_PUSHBYTES_20 bebcdbb4fe2f0ba80ca8a86d35cee30bc800f1f4
- address
- ltc1qh67dhd879u96sr9g4pkntnhrp0yqpu05474knw